to crimp
01
friser
to make tight curls in someone's hair using a hair iron
Transitive: to crimp hair
Exemples
She crimped her hair before the party to achieve a unique and playful hairstyle.
Elle a frisé ses cheveux avant la fête pour obtenir une coiffure unique et ludique.
02
plisser, crêper
to create small folds or ridges in something by pinching or pressing it together
Transitive: to crimp sth
Exemples
The baker used a fork to crimp the edges of the pastry, sealing the contents.
Le boulanger a utilisé une fourchette pour crépir les bords de la pâtisserie, scellant ainsi son contenu.
